What is the difference between a sink strainer and a drain stopper?

A drain stopper is designed to block water so the sink can fill, while a sink strainer is designed to let water pass while catching solid debris. The Kitchen SinkShroom is a strainer, so it keeps water flowing and prevents clogs rather than holding water in the sink.
